MISSION STATEMENT

“Conquerors Day By Day”

…..we are more than conquerors through Him that loved us. (Romans 8:37)

 Day By Day (DBD) is a website dedicated to inspire, encourage, & enlighten all those who visit about the salvation, hope, & love of Yahushua the Messiah.  To provide a word of knowledge, a listening ear, and an understanding heart to all who seek comfort.  To bring the joy & power of Yahweh’s word, the Holy Bible, to lives & strengthen hope in the living God. 

My name is Dwan Avent and I am founder and creator of this website.  I am a survivor and advocate of domestic violence.  I am only trying to give back a little of what has been given to me.  As the famous quote reads below:  “If I can ease ONE life the aching, or cool ONE pain”, then my effort here will be well worth it and I have not lived in vain.

DBD restores to The Father & The Son their true Hebrew names:  Yahweh (the Father) & Yahushua (the Son), but still use God, Jesus, & Lord for communication purposes.  Please do not take my word if you’re uncomfortable with their Hebrews names.  I encourage you, please research this for yourselves.  A Hebrew & Greek Lexicon is vital when studying the holy scriptures, as the original Bible (old testament) was written in Hebrew.  The new testament was written in Greek.  If you find anything not to be true, please, by all means, let me know.  However, with correct study, I know you will find those names to be true!  I came to this knowledge in 2001.  I also use Selah, which a close translation means “pause & calmly think of that” throughout my writings.  I’d also like to point out that the Hebrew alphabet is in the Holy Bible throughout Psalm 119.  They may look like symbols in some translations.  Other translations have translated the alphabet to English.  Scriptures in this website were taken from the Holy Bible:   King James Version (KJV) & New King James Version (NKJV), unless otherwise noted.
